Calycanthus brockianus is a species in the genus Calycanthus, belonging to the family Calycanthaceae. It is commonly known as Georgia sweetshrub and is native to North America, specifically Georgia. The species was first described in 1987 by Ferry & Ferry f.

Description

Calycanthus brockianus, known as Georgia sweetshrub, is a member of the Calycanthaceae family. It is endemic to the state of Georgia in North America. This species was formally published in 1987 by the authors Ferry & Ferry f. It is one of several species within the genus Calycanthus, which is characterized by aromatic shrubs with distinctive flowers.
